🌍ubiquitious

adjective
/juːˈbɪkwɪtəs/

Meaning

Present, appearing, or found everywhere.

Example Sentences

Smartphones have become ubiquitous in modern society.

Synonyms

omnipresent, pervasive, universal, widespread, common

Antonyms

rare, scarce, uncommon

Collocations

ubiquitous presence, ubiquitous influence, ubiquitous technology, ubiquitous role
